The Board of Ghushine Fintrrade Ocean Ltd, which was earlier focused on finance and textiles/jewellery trading, approved adding two new main objects: renewable and clean energy (solar, wind, hydro, biomass, green hydrogen, battery storage, power trading) and agro/food processing and trading. It also tripled its authorised share capital from Rs. 10 crore (1 crore equity shares) to Rs. 32 crore (3.20 crore equity shares) of Rs. 10 each, and adopted a new set of Articles of Association. Independent Director Mrs. Bhaviniben Lankapati resigned, and Mr. Sagar Kumbhani (25+ years in construction) was appointed as Non-Executive Independent Director for 5 years. Statutory auditor M/s. APMM & Co. resigned citing pre-occupation, and M/s. A R G S & Associates was appointed till the next AGM. All key items will go to shareholders via postal ballot.
Retail investors should note a major strategic pivot toward renewable energy and agro businesses, backed by a 220% increase in authorised capital headroom that may enable future fundraising or share issuance. The rapid back-to-back changes in directors and auditors, alongside a wholesale shift in business objects, are governance items to watch, but the actual impact on the stock depends on how the new businesses are executed and funded.
